Comparisons to other technologies perhaps wrongBy Andrew Booth
Posted Monday 19th March 2007 09:16 GMT
Why are you comparing Apollo to desktop widgets? Apollo is intended to build rich client applications, not just dashboard widgets. And the Microsoft technologies to compare it with are surely Microsoft ASP.NET AJAX Extensions and WPF/E (Windows Presentation Foundation Everywhere). Further, you suggest that Microsoft limits UI design. Flex/Apollo are similar, with standard UI controls. This is hardly the case now with WPF based interfaces in Vista, with funky UI designs built in the Expression products. I feel this article missed out discussion of some key new technologies.
